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Llandudno Junction to Redcar Central start from as little as £33.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Llandudno Junction to Redcar Central are available for £110.20 one way, or £192.20 return

Facilities and Services

At Redcar Central, ticket purchasing and collection is made easy with a ticket office that operates from 07:05 to 13:30 on weekdays and ticket machines available for cash and card transactions. For those planning to collect tickets bought online, you'll find convenient machines ready for use. The station also accommodates passengers with hearing impairments via an induction loop system. While the station lacks waiting rooms, there’s a seating area, ensuring you have a cozy spot to sit.

Step-free access is partially available, with a level crossing allowing entry to both platforms. However, moving between platforms might require a little patience as level transfer is possible but lengthy, urging careful planning especially for those with mobility challenges. As for your safety, CCTV is in place throughout the premises. However, remember that there are no accessible taxi services directly from the station.

If you’re heading to the station by car, you’ll find parking easily available with 60 spaces at your disposal, including one specifically for accessible parking. Bicycle enthusiasts will appreciate the 16 bicycle storage spaces, featuring a mix of lockers and stands, catering to varied storage needs.

Onward Travel Options

Redcar Central perfectly interlinks with various transport modalities, ensuring seamless connectivity. For bus services, you can head to the bus stop right at the front of the station, with Busline available at 0871 200 2233 for more information. If you find yourself in need of a taxi, make use of the Cab4You service to arrange a ride with just a few clicks. In cases of rail service interruptions, rail replacement services can be accessed nearby on Westdyke Road.
